Web25 sep. 2010 · 1 answer. Baking soda is a pure substance, NaHCO3, sodium bicarbonate (or in the new naming system it is sodium hydrogen carbonate). answered by DrBob222. WebBaking soda is 100% sodium bicarbonate NaHCO3 and is, therefore, a compound, as opposed to baking powder which is a mixture of baking soda and various acidic ingredients. Baking powder is made up of a base, an acid and a buffering material, which stops the acid and base reacting together.
